Dimensions | |||
Length: | 4.72 m | 4.48 m | |
Width: | 1.76 m | 1.72 m | |
Height: | 1.42 m | 1.41 m | |
Volvo V70 is larger. Volvo V70 is 24 cm longer than the Volvo S40, 4 cm wider the height of the cars does not differ significantly. | |||
Trunk capacity: | 420 litres | 471 litres | |
Trunk max capacity: with rear seats folded down |
1580 litres | 853 litres | |
Despite its longer length, Volvo V70 has 51 litres less trunk space than the Volvo S40. This could mean that the Volvo V70 uses more space in the cabin, so the driver and passengers could be more spacious and comfortable. The maximum boot capacity (with all rear seats folded down) is larger in Volvo V70 (by 727 litres). | |||
Turning diameter: | 11.3 meters | 11 meters | |
The turning circle of the Volvo V70 is 0.3 metres more than that of the Volvo S40. | |||
